Transcribed Image Text:Question 44 of 50 Submit What is the pH of a 0.00100 M solution of HCI? 1 3 4 6. C 7 8 9. +/- x 100 II
Expert Solution
Step 1 pH

Negative logarithm of His called pH, to know the acidity of dilute solutions pH is introduced.

pH = - log[H+]. 

Where [HCl] = [H+] = 0.001M

Since HCl is strong acid hence it can dissociate completely. 

Therefore 

    pH = - log[0.001]

           = -(-3) 

           = 3
